Hartsfield Jackson Atlanta International Airport

Runway 09R at KATL

Runway 09R/27L at Hartsfield Jackson Atlanta International Airport (KATL) in Atlanta is a 9,001 ft, lighted, concrete runway oriented 090°/270°. The runway is 150 ft wide. SkyMeter has observed 4,827 landings and 12 departures on this runway over the last 30 days, with approximately 0.1% of arrivals resulting in a go-around (3 events). Trace data shows an average final-approach slope of 1.3°, touchdowns averaging 1,845 ft past the threshold, a typical touchdown ground speed of 141 kt, a 5.4 kt average crosswind component, a 4.9 kt average headwind.

Approach Types and Categories

Aircraft approach runways using different procedures based on weather conditions, visibility, and available navigation equipment. An Instrument Landing System (ILS) approach provides precision horizontal and vertical guidance using ground-based radio signals, enabling aircraft to land in low visibility conditions. Visual approaches require pilots to maintain visual contact with the runway and surrounding terrain, typically used during clear weather. Area Navigation (RNAV) approaches use GPS technology to guide aircraft along specific flight paths.

Approach Categories Explained

Category (CAT) classifications define minimum visibility and decision height requirements for instrument approaches. Higher categories enable operations in lower visibility conditions.
